Overview

STARLIMS provides leading Laboratory Information Management Systems (LIMS) solutions that have served customers around the world for over 30 years. STARLIMS solution suite helps to improve the reliability of laboratory sampling processes, manage complex testing workflows and analytical methods, support compliance with global regulatory requirements and industry standards, and provide comprehensive reporting, monitoring, and analysis capabilities. With multiple support centers across the globe in North America, EMEA and APAC, STARLIMS solutions are used in labs across multiple industries and disciplines including pharma & biotech, life sciences, food & beverage, manufacturing, petrochemical refineries and oil & gas, chemical, public health, forensics and environmental offering an influx of global career opportunities.


STARLIMS is looking for a Deputy Director of Quality and Regulatory Affairs.


Responsibilities


  • Administrative Support – scheduling meetings, preparing reports, and maintaining audit and CAPA schedules.

  • Audit Support – prepare for internal and external quality audits by organizing documentation and ensuring compliance with relevant standards (ISO 9001 and ISO 27001) and HIPAA and GDPR regulations.

  • Process Support – Assist in implementing and monitoring quality processes and systems to ensure they meet organizational standards and objectives.

  • Training and Compliance – Manage internal employee training in the STARlearn (LITMOS) system, provide data on training completion rates, create training modules as needed, and ensure training is completed promptly.

  • Data Collection and Analysis – Gather and organize quality-related data to support internal audits, management reviews, and continual improvement efforts. Have a statistical analysis background to analyze data and identify trends that support the QMS system.

  • Continual Improvement – participate in projects aimed at improving the efficiency and effectiveness of the quality and information security management systems.


Qualifications

Required Experience: Previous experience working with ISO 9001:2015 and ISO 27001:2022 standards, either as an internal or external auditor or Quality Assistant. Certification with ASQ or Exemplar Global is a plus.


Self-starter – must be able to work with minimal supervision, pro-active, open to new concepts, and engage with others without prompting.


Attention to Detail – must be meticulous in work approach to ensure accurate record-keeping and quality control.


Organizational Skills – Must be able to manage multiple tasks, documents, and projects without reminders.


Computer Proficiency – MS Office Suite, SharePoint, Salesforce, LITMOS LIMS, Zendesk.


Problem solving – must be able to identify minor issues and contribute to finding solutions.
